# Break-Glass: Catalog Cache Invalidation

Scope: the Pinrow product catalog at Veldstone Retail. If stale prices persist after a purge and the Hollowmere invalidation queue is wedged, use break-glass to flush the edge tier directly. Contractors: get verbal sign-off from the catalog lead first. Steps: open the Hollowmere admin shell, select emergency-flush, confirm the tenant, and run it once — repeated flushes thrash the origin. Access is logged and expires after 20 minutes. Unseal the admin shell with the passphrase below.

recovery phrase for kahop-tajog: istix-casvan

## FAQ: Partner SFTP drop for Meridell feeds

Partners upload nightly files to the Meridell SFTP drop. If a partner reports failed uploads, first check the intake queue status page. Should the drop itself be unresponsive, restart it from the recovery console, which operates independently of standard credentials. Record the restart in the support log. The console's recovery passphrase follows.

unlock words, faweg-fahop: wendor-kelmir-ulaeth-holael

Subject: Inkwell markdown pipeline 5.1 deployed

On-call: the Inkwell rendering pipeline is now on 5.1 in production. Changes: sanitizer runs before the table parser, footnote rendering is cached per document, and the fallback plain-text path no longer strips headings. If render latency alarms fire, roll back via the standard script — it handles cache invalidation. Known issue: nested blockquotes over six levels render flat. The deployment trace token follows.

build token for hawep-kageg: htk14_558814e2114cc7

/*
 * Client for Cluewright, the crossword generator backend.
 * Security review: TLS enforced, cert pinned to the internal CA.
 * Scope limited to grid-fill and clue-lookup endpoints; no write
 * access. Rotation handled by the Keyloft scheduler, 30-day cycle.
 * The client authenticates to Keyloft with the key below.
 */

gateway credential: kto3_qfe